About SAC:
The Student Activity Council (SAC) serves as the central
platform for students to actively engage in university affairs. Functioning as
a student-run representative body under responsible supervision, the Council
ensures that students play a meaningful role in shaping campus life. By
collaborating with faculty, staff, and parents, SAC works to advance the shared
interests of both the institution and its students. Through the planning and
execution of institutional events, cultural activities, and volunteer
initiatives, SAC provides students with invaluable opportunities to develop leadership,
teamwork, and organizational skills. It also serves as a vital channel for
students to express their thoughts, passions, and concerns within the larger
community of the institute. The Council is organized into **five dynamic
clubs—Literary, Sports, Technical, Discipline, and Cultural—**each contributing
uniquely to the holistic growth of students. Under the esteemed guidance of Dr.
Smruti Ranjan Rath, Dean of Student Welfare, these clubs have consistently
pursued their objectives with dedication, enriching student life and advancing
the ideals of our institution.

Committees under
SAC
- Cultural Committee:
The committee plans and executes large-scale cultural festivals, including
music festivals and dance competitions. The committee plays a vital role in
enriching the student life at AISECT University by promoting cultural
awareness, nurturing artistic talent, and fostering a vibrant and inclusive
community.
- Literary Committee:
The Committee serves as a beacon of literary expression at ASIECT University.
Through its diverse initiatives, it cultivates a thriving literary community,
empowers aspiring writers, and celebrates the transformative power of the
written word. It organises a variety of literary competitions throughout the
year, encompassing poetry, short story writing, essay writing, scriptwriting,
and spoken word performances. These competitions provide a platform for
students to express their creativity, receive constructive feedback, and hone
their literary skills.
- Technical
Committee: The Technical Committee, the dynamic technical committee of the
Student Activity Council at AISECT University, bridges the gap between academic
knowledge and practical application in the ever-evolving world of technology.
The committee conducts engaging quizzes and workshops on diverse technological
topics, from hardware assembly and cyber security to robotics and artificial
intelligence.
- Sports Committee: The
committee serves as the driving force of sports culture at AISECT University.
Through its diverse initiatives, the committee fosters athletic talent,
promotes inclusivity and participation, and champions the spirit of
sportsmanship within the student community and beyond. Velocity organises
vibrant inter-college tournaments across a wide range of sports, from
traditional disciplines like cricket, carom, chess, and volleyball to emerging
sports like basketball and badminton. These tournaments foster healthy competition,
promote inter-college companionship, and provide platforms for showcasing
athletic talent.
- Discipline
Committee: The discipline committee plays a crucial role in maintaining a
smooth and safe campus environment. The committee plays a vital role in
ensuring a safe, fair, and responsible student experience at AISECT
University. Through its investigations
and commitment to due process, the committee contributes to a thriving
university community where ethical conduct and respect are valued by all.
These committees
have core members and in-charge senior students, i.e., conveners, who look
after all the activities to be held by specific committees.
The Criteria to be
a Part of SAC
To become a part of the Student Activity Council (SAC), students are
expected to demonstrate qualities that reflect both academic dedication and
personal responsibility. The following criteria serve as the foundation for
selection:- Academic and Extracurricular Balance :- Students must maintain a strong academic record while
actively participating in extracurricular activities, ensuring all-round
growth.
- Regularity, Discipline, and Punctuality :- Consistent attendance, adherence to rules, and punctuality
are essential for maintaining the integrity and smooth functioning of the
Council.
- Team Spirit:- Members should possess the ability to work effectively in
groups, showing respect, cooperation, and commitment to collective goals.
- Leadership and Guidance :- Leaders or conveners are expected to guide their committees
responsibly, fostering harmony and ensuring smooth execution of activities
without conflicts or dominance of personal ideas.
- Impartiality in Competitions :- Conveners are prohibited from participating in the events or
competitions organized by their own committees to avoid any perception of bias
in judgment.
- Committee Size :- Each committee is limited to a maximum of eight core members,
ensuring manageable teams and effective coordination.
